I was halfway through this book when I realized it was a continuation of the story of the family introduced in There, There. If I had read that first, I probably would have understood better and wouldn’t have been so confused by what was happening when I got the present day chapters. I had some mixed feelings about this book. On one hand, I found it confusing and hard to follow because of all the time jumps and switches between the points of views of different characters. At the same time, I appreciated the context that Orange added to the story by including the perspectives of the generations who came before. I had more compassion for characters struggling with addiction and depression because I understood that they were affected by the generational trauma of violence, displacement, and parental loss. While the writing was beautiful, the book was slow-paced and a heavy read.

I hadn’t read There There yet, so I didn’t realize this was a kind of prequel/sequel—but it absolutely stands on its own. Wandering Stars is a powerful, beautifully written exploration of personal and generational trauma, and what it means to exist in the wake of a culture that a government has tried to systematically erase.
Orange’s writing is rich with intention. While I wished a few plot threads were followed through more fully—especially to circle back to the novel’s beginning—I also understood that choice as part of the book’s larger themes: loss, disconnection, and the long shadow of forced assimilation.
What really stood out to me was how grounded and thoroughly researched everything felt. There’s nothing sensationalized here—just truth, grief, and resilience. The novel also does an incredible job connecting these themes to issues that continue to devastate communities today, particularly the opioid crisis and gun violence.

I love Orange and will read any books he writes. He is lovely and very personable. I am just not sure that I was in a good place mentally to read such a depressing book of such generational trauma. (Note: The last couple of chapters were inspirational and uplifting but it was a slow arduous climb to get there.) There, There is definitely my favorite of the two novels (although my signed copy has disappeared from my classroom library).
